Common Artificial Stone Installation Jobs
Kitchen countertops - artificial stone provides durable, low-maintenance surfaces for cooking and prep areas.
Bathroom vanities - seamless installation of artificial stone enhances bathroom aesthetics and resists moisture.
Fireplace surrounds - artificial stone offers heat-resistant, stylish options for fireplace accents.
Outdoor kitchens - weather-resistant artificial stone surfaces are ideal for outdoor cooking and entertainment areas.
Accent walls - artificial stone can create attractive, textured interior or exterior feature walls.
Commercial spaces - durable artificial stone surfaces are suitable for high-traffic commercial environments.
Artificial Stone Installation Questions
What is artificial stone used for? Artificial stone is commonly used for countertops, fireplaces, wall cladding, and outdoor surfaces in residential and commercial properties.
How durable is artificial stone installation? Artificial stone is designed to be resistant to scratches, stains, and weather conditions, making it suitable for various high-traffic and outdoor areas.
Can artificial stone be customized to match existing decor? Yes, artificial stone comes in a variety of colors and textures that can be selected to complement existing design elements.
What types of projects typically require artificial stone installation? Projects often include kitchen and bathroom countertops, feature walls, outdoor kitchens, and fireplace surrounds.
